GULF OF MEXICO...
A 1021 MB SURFACE HIGH IS OVER THE E GULF NEAR 28N83W...AND A
1021 MB SURFACE HIGH IS OVER THE W ATLC NEAR 28N74W. BROAD
SURFACE ANTICYCLONIC FLOW AROUND THESE SURFACE HIGHS COVERS MUCH
OF THE GULF REGION. ALSO...SUBSIDENCE ASSOCIATED WITH THESE
SURFACE HIGHS IS RESULTING IN ATMOSPHERIC STABILITY AND FAIR
WEATHER CONDITIONS ACROSS MUCH OF THE GULF REGION. THIS
STABILITY IS BEING ENHANCED IN THE VICINITY OF A BROAD UPPER
LEVEL RIDGE EXTENDING ACROSS THE GULF REGION FROM AN UPPER HIGH
CENTERED NW OF HISPANIOLA NEAR 21N73W. THIS UPPER RIDGE IS
ASSOCIATED WITH RELATIVELY LIGHT AND BROAD ANTICYCLONIC FLOW
ALOFT...AND DEEP LAYER DRY AIR...AFFECTING MUCH OF THE GULF
REGION. FARTHER TO THE N...A DEEP LONGWAVE TROUGH WITH AN
ASSOCIATED STRONG UPPER LEVEL JET MAXIMUM OVER THE CENTRAL CONUS
IS SUPPORTING A SURFACE FRONT EXTENDING FROM THE MID-ATLANTIC
STATES ACROSS THE SOUTHERN PLAINS AND INTO THE SOUTHERN ROCKY
MOUNTAIN REGION OF THE CONUS. THE FRONT IS EXPECTED TO MOVE
SOUTHWARD ACROSS THE GULF ON SUNDAY AND MONDAY AS A COLD FRONT.
INCREASED NE SURFACE WINDS ARE FORECAST IN THE WAKE OF THE COLD
FRONT...WITH GALE FORCE WINDS EXPECTED SUNDAY AFTERNOON AND
NIGHT FOR PORTIONS OF THE NW GULF.

CARIBBEAN SEA...
SUBSIDENCE IN WESTERLY FLOW ALOFT AND ATMOSPHERIC STABILITY
COVER THE CARIBBEAN REGION...WHERE GENERALLY DEEP LAYER DRY AIR
IS PRESENT. THESE FACTORS ARE RESULTING IN FAIR WEATHER
CONDITIONS ACROSS MUCH THE CARIBBEAN REGION. THE SOUTHERN
PERIPHERY OF THE BROAD SURFACE ANTICYCLONIC FLOW AROUND THE
AFOREMENTIONED SURFACE HIGHS OVER THE E GULF AND W ATLC IS
BRINGING NE SURFACE WINDS OF 10 TO 20 KT TO THE CARIBBEAN
REGION...EXCEPT UP TO 25 KT NEAR THE COAST OF COLOMBIA. UPPER
LEVEL MOISTURE IS STREAMING NORTHWARD FROM SOUTH AMERICA INTO
THE SE CARIBBEAN...WITH ISOLATED SHOWERS ACROSS THE S CARIBBEAN
S OF 12N E OF 68W. ALSO...A SURFACE TROUGH EXTENDS FROM THE W
ATLC NEAR 27N58W TO 22N63W TO THE NE CARIBBEAN NEAR
17N66W...WITH SATELLITE IMAGERY DEPICTING CYCLONIC MOTION OF
CLOUDS IN THE VICINITY OF THIS SURFACE TROUGH. LOW LEVEL
CONVERGENCE IS RESULTING IN ISOLATED SHOWERS WITHIN 60 NM EITHER
SIDE OF THIS SURFACE TROUGH.

ATLANTIC OCEAN...
A 1021 MB SURFACE HIGH IS CENTERED IN THE W ATLC NEAR 28N74W...
WITH A 1021 MB SURFACE HIGH IN THE E GULF OF MEXICO NEAR 28N83W.
THESE SURFACE HIGHS ARE BRINGING SUBSIDENCE AND FAIR WEATHER
CONDITIONS TO MUCH OF THE W ATLC. THIS SUBSIDENCE IS BEING
ENHANCED IN THE VICINITY OF THE UPPER HIGH NW OF HISPANIOLA NEAR
21N73W. NORTHERLY UPPER LEVEL FLOW TO THE E OF THIS UPPER HIGH
IS ADVECTING UPPER LEVEL MOISTURE ACROSS PORTIONS OF THE W ATLC.
FARTHER TO THE E...A SURFACE TROUGH OVER THE CENTRAL ATLC
EXTENDS FROM 29N46W TO 26N48W TO 22N48W. LOW LEVEL CONVERGENCE
ASSOCIATED WITH THIS SURFACE TROUGH IS RESULTING IN NUMEROUS
SHOWERS FROM 21N-30N BETWEEN 39W-44W. THIS ACTIVITY IS BEING
ENHANCED BY ATMOSPHERIC INSTABILITY IN THE VICINITY OF AN UPPER
TROUGH WITH AN AXIS EXTENDING FROM 18N60W TO 27N48W TO 32N45W TO
N OF THE DISCUSSION AREA. ALSO...UPPER LEVEL DIVERGENCE
ASSOCIATED WITH AN 80-90-KT UPPER LEVEL JET MAXIMUM E OF THE
UPPER TROUGH AXIS IS SUPPORTING THIS ACTIVITY...ALONG WITH LOW
LEVEL CONVERGENCE ASSOCIATED WITH A WEAKENING SURFACE STATIONARY
FRONT EXTENDING FROM NW OF THE DISCUSSION AREA TO 32N58W TO
31N56W AND A SURFACE COLD FRONT EXTENDING FROM 32N45W TO NE OF
THE DISCUSSION AREA. ACROSS THE E ATLC...SUBSIDENCE ASSOCIATED
WITH A SURFACE RIDGE EXTENDING SOUTHWESTWARD FROM A 1036 MB
SURFACE HIGH NEAR 45N10W IS GENERALLY INHIBITING DEEP CONVECTION
N OF 16N E OF 35W. HOWEVER...ATMOSPHERIC INSTABILITY ASSOCIATED
WITH AN UPPER LOW NEAR 31N18W IS RESULTING IN SCATTERED SHOWERS
N OF 28N BETWEEN 16W-22W. THIS ACTIVITY IS BEING ENHANCED BY LOW
LEVEL CONVERGENCE IN THE VICINITY OF A SURFACE TROUGH EXTENDING
FROM 31N11W TO 32N10W TO NE OF THE DISCUSSION AREA. FARTHER TO
THE S...A SURFACE TROUGH EXTENDS FROM 27N58W TO 22N63W TO THE NE
CARIBBEAN NEAR 17N66W...WITH SATELLITE IMAGERY DEPICTING
CYCLONIC MOTION OF CLOUDS IN THE VICINITY OF THIS SURFACE
TROUGH. LOW LEVEL CONVERGENCE IS RESULTING IN ISOLATED SHOWERS
WITHIN 60 NM EITHER SIDE OF THIS SURFACE TROUGH. ALSO...AN UPPER
RIDGE IS S OF 14N BETWEEN 19W-51W. UPPER LEVEL DIFFLUENCE
ASSOCIATED WITH THIS UPPER RIDGE IS ENHANCING THE CONVECTION
ASSOCIATED WITH THE ITCZ.
